With 6 lakh ranking, the chances of getting BDS and BHMS seat is very less even for private institutions. You can go with management seat if possible, but the fee will be around 5 to 6 lakhs per annum. It cannot be said for sure that you can get a seat, as the number of available seats are very less than number of applicants.

Secondly, you have not mentioned your exact score. In order to apply for any college under any quota, you need have qualified NEET i.e, the mnimum marks is 720-147 for General category.
